A202051 Number of (n+2) X 9 binary arrays avoiding patterns 001 and 110 in rows and columns. 1
1926, 7848, 25650, 71964, 180054, 411696, 874998, 1750140, 3325410, 6046344, 10581246, 17906868, 29418570, 47069856, 73546794, 112483476, 168725358, 248648040, 360539802, 515057004, 725762286, 1009756368, 1388415150 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

FORMULA
Empirical: a(n) = (1/10080)*n^9 + (3/560)*n^8 + (211/1680)*n^7 + (67/40)*n^6 + (6709/480)*n^5 + (6041/80)*n^4 + (663941/2520)*n^3 + (79913/140)*n^2 + (4735/7)*n + 324.
Conjectures from Colin Barker, May 26 2018: (Start)
G.f.: 18*x*(107 - 634*x + 1880*x^2 - 3472*x^3 + 4298*x^4 - 3652*x^5 + 2114*x^6 - 800*x^7 + 179*x^8 - 18*x^9) / (1 - x)^10.
a(n) = 10*a(n-1) - 45*a(n-2) + 120*a(n-3) - 210*a(n-4) + 252*a(n-5) - 210*a(n-6) + 120*a(n-7) - 45*a(n-8) + 10*a(n-9) - a(n-10) for n>10.
(End)
